Doesn't make sense to me.  The RTT for an ICMP packet can be a
significant part of a second (think Europe-Australia the wrong way
around cause that is where all the bandwidth is, or when satellites
are involved).  I think this means that a single dropped packet could
result in a failure to resolve one of the hops on such a path.

I don't necessarily object to giving folks the ammunition to shoot
themselves into the foot by dropping the minimum value to 1 second.
But the default should be larger I think.

> > The default traceroute timeout of 5 seconds is excruciatingly long
> > when there are elements of the route that don't respond, and it
> > wasn't allowed to be set lower than 2 seconds.
> >
> > This changes the minimum to 1 second, matching FreeBSD, and also
> > makes that the default, which should be reasonable for the vast
> > majority of users today.
> >
> > The two awk files in this directory are two decades old, and
> > not installed anywhere they can be executed as part of a traceroute
> > pipeline; can they be removed? If the functionality is useful,
> > implementing mean/median reporting as a new option in C would be
> > straightforward.
